Output e066b276a6a72e8951a79010ab6ae7ab7bfd408869c399445e2bbc1949cbd89d:0

value
8300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d009c423ed6b89104d89f84f4fbb15f2285c8eda OP_EQUAL
address
3Lf2B1YCfr1AWfPGsrAdbJC4G7tvpGEEZ4
transaction
e066b276a6a72e8951a79010ab6ae7ab7bfd408869c399445e2bbc1949cbd89d
confirmations
164606
spent
true